What does denaturation mean and why is it important? Denaturation isthe alteration of a protein shape through some form of external stress(for example, by applying heat, acid or alkali), in such a way that it will no longer be able to carry out its cellular function. ... The final shap...
For example, many proteins break down in response to alcohol exposure, and introducing alcohol to an organism can inhibit the activities of a number of enzymes. Acids have similar effects. Likewise, heat tends to denature enzymes, pulling the protein strands apart and rendering them ineffective; ...
